"I am told by a few that the angle of my wing is not steep enough
to add much downforce so it works for my car...."
Be careful with this one. How well versed are the those who opine in aero? A properly shaped wing will generate downforce with the top side of the wing parallel to the ground. The cord angle will still be angled down giving you the downforce desired. While tipping the nose of the wing down will increase downforce, it increases drag as well limiting top speed. It is a dance and optimal settings depend on objective.
I'm not an expert in wing design. However, I have built them for open wheel racing and played with a lot of settings as driver to learn the obvious is not.
